Would-be car buyers prioritize fuel efficiency, safety, low pricing, comfort, warranties, resale value, and most importantly, reliability in new car purchases.
Consumer Reports' Annual Auto Surveys analyze 20 trouble areas to assign reliability scores from 1 to 100, helping identify potentially troublesome vehicles among over 330,000 models reviewed.
